EDITORS COMMENTS
This striking engraving of Truganini, a prominent Tasmanian Aboriginal woman, captures her strength and resilience in the face of immense challenges. Truganini was a key figure in the history of Tasmania during the 19th century, known for her leadership and advocacy for her people.
The detailed engraving showcases Truganini's features with remarkable precision, highlighting her dignified expression and powerful presence. As one of the last full-blooded Tasmanian Aboriginals, she played a crucial role in preserving the cultural heritage of her people amidst colonization and violence.
Created as an illustration for the Picturesque Atlas of Australasia in 1886, this image serves as a poignant reminder of Australia's complex history and the ongoing struggles faced by Indigenous communities.
